Safety
You might think of the older radiators you find in offices and homes. Modern radiator heaters with oil, on the other hand, are smaller and more portable oil radiator heater than earlier models. They can be utilized as a second source of heat in large spaces like living rooms and dining areas or utilized as the primary heating source in smaller spaces such as kitchens and bedrooms.
Oil filled radiators work in a very similar manner to other electric heaters. The heaters are powered by an electric element that heats up a reservoir of thermal oils inside the appliance. The hot oil is circulated by metal fins, which then become extremely hot. The hot oil warms up the air that is passing over the radiator and warms the rest of the space.
Oil-filled radiators heat rooms much quicker than other types. The oil is heated, and then pumped into the room via the fins made of metal. They are also less likely to damage walls or furniture since they don't contain any heating elements that are exposed.
Keep your radiators with oil-filled heating elements away from any flammable items like draperies and curtains. This is due to the fact that these items could ignite if placed too close to heating elements or when the heater is not functioning properly. It is best oil filled radiator for large rooms to keep heaters at least two feet away from combustible materials.
It is also recommended to keep your heaters away from humid areas, like bathrooms, as they could be susceptible to rust. If you do have a radiator in your bathroom, it is recommended to install a vent to allow for proper air circulation. Keep your heaters from reach of children and pets. They are easily damaged or burnt if they are not secured properly.
Energy Efficiency
A small, oil-filled radiator is the best option to maximize energy efficiency. These heaters are equipped with a thermal fluid that is extremely efficient in its heat. It will remain warm for a long time after the unit has been turned off. This lets heat be spread evenly throughout the room before it slowly cools, saving you money. Many models also have programmable timers and thermostats, allowing users to create heating schedules that are tailored to their lifestyles.
A small electric heater can provide instant, intense heating. It is easily controlled by a dial, a digital display, or both. In addition, the absence of a fan means that these heaters are quieter and can be used in a bedroom or office without disturbing others.
A small heater that is filled with oil may take longer to warm up than other electric heaters. However, it has excellent properties for heat retention that increase efficiency and lower operating costs over time. This is especially true if the unit is equipped with a temperature control programable that will automatically switch the unit to an efficient mode if the temperature decreases.
A small, oil-filled heater is an ideal choice for any space in the home such as garages, bedrooms conservatories, living rooms, and garages. They are also ideal for temporary solutions in the event that central heating is not working or as an alternative to wall-mounted heaters. They provide a flexible heating option with built-in wheels or casters to facilitate easy mobility and simple digital controls and energy-saving features, such as tip-over and overheat protection.
Oil-filled radiators are an excellent option for leaving on overnight since they do not have moving parts. They are also constructed with safety in mind. This is especially important when you have pets or children that could accidentally knock the heater over. If you need to refill your heater, it's best to leave this to the experts. Doing it at home is risky.
